What is the primary purpose of farm surveying in agriculture?
Mapping land boundaries
Determining soil fertility
Assessing crop yield
Identifying pest infestations
Correct answer is A
The primary purpose of farm surveying in agriculture is to accurately map the land boundaries of a farm. Farm surveying involves the measurement and mapping of land to establish property lines, determine field sizes and shapes, and demarcate boundaries between different land parcels.
